Chapecoense stun Corinthians as Marcinho brace ends away drought

Chapecoense beat Corinthians 2-1 on Sunday in São Paulo, ending a 20-match away league drought and dropping the hosts from 10th to 11th in the Brasileirão.
In the second minute, Matheus Bidu put Timão ahead, finishing from the centre of the box after Gustavo Henrique recycled a set piece.
Marcinho levelled with a glancing header from Heitor's cross (40.).
Breno Bidon then thought he had restored the lead, but his strike was overturned by VAR in the first minute of first half stoppage time.
After the restart, substitute Yannick Bolasie teed up Marcinho to slam in the winner from close range (77.).
Chape's goalkeeper Anderson made five saves and preserved the points by stopping Pedro Raúl's close-range header in the third minute of second half stoppage time.
Timão had 62.1% possession and tallied 16 attempts. Chape registered seven attempts, with five on target.
Next, Timão visit Estudiantes in the Libertadores. Chape host Internacional in the Brasileirão.
